The eggs, identified as belonging to titanosaurs – the biggest sauropods known – were found embedded in sediment layers that suggest a cold, seasonal environment. Their discovery challenges the long‑standing view that these massive herbivores nested only in warm, low‑latitude regions. Hamro Patro reported that titanosaurs laid eggs in cold regions, while iflscience.com noted the nests represent the highest latitude sauropod discoveries and may have relied on rotting vegetation for warmth.

The Globe and Mail highlighted the involvement of a Canadian researcher in the team that documented the find. CBC explored how the embryos could have hatched despite cooler climates, and CNN emphasized the unexpected nature of the location. The discovery expands the known geographic range of titanosaur reproduction and prompts a re‑evaluation of how these giants managed thermoregulation in nest sites.

Ongoing analyses of the sediment and eggshell composition aim to confirm the proposed heating mechanism and to refine models of dinosaur behavior in polar environments.
